Kraftwerk Restaurant & Winebar is a top culinary destination in Zell am See, Austria. Housed in a historic 1974 power plant, the restaurant offers contemporary and inventive Austrian and European dishes. Many of the ingredients such as bacon, bread, and brandy are sourced from their own organic farm while the wild game comes from the surrounding area. The restaurant boasts impeccable service, a friendly and knowledgeable staff, and an impressive wine list.

Located at the northern entrance to Zell am See, Seewirt - Das Restaurant is a popular dining spot known for its traditional Austrian dishes with a modern twist. The unassuming stone and wood chalet offers a cozy ambiance where guests can savor delectable meals such as braised beef cheek with balsamic vinegar and raspberries, zander fish with mustard foam, and pumpkin soup.

Schloss Prielau is a luxurious hotel located in a 15th-century castle in Zell am See. The renowned restaurant, led by top chef Andreas Mayer, offers exceptional cuisine with strong flavors and combinations. The venue is popular for weddings due to the passionate and dedicated wedding coordinator, Anette Mayer. Guests praise the beautiful location, exquisite food, and impeccable service at Schloss Prielau.
